专业网站建设品牌,十四年专业建站经验,服务6000+客户--广州京杭网络
免费热线:400-683-0016      微信咨询  |  联系我们

如何更清楚的认识自己的Java基础_java

当前位置:网站建设 > 技术支持
资料来源:网络整理       时间:2023/3/7 0:39:41       共计:3578 浏览

如何更清楚的认识自己的Java基础?

谢谢邀请!

作为一名从业多年的Java程序员,同时也出版过Java编程书籍,所以我来回答一下这个问题。

Java程序员要想清楚的认识自身的Java基础知识,应该从以下三个方面来衡量:

第一:对于抽象的理解。Java程序开发的核心是抽象,不论是使用Java进行应用级开发(Web开发、Android开发等),还是使用Java进行研发级开发(平台开发、容器开发等),都需要理解Java中的抽象,所以也说学习Java就是学习抽象。关于抽象的理解涉及到对于面向对象编程的理解程度,几乎包括Java所有重要且基础的编程概念,包括类、抽象类、接口、多态等等。

第二:对于Java虚拟机的理解。Java开发是基于Java虚拟机的,Java虚拟机完成Java代码的跨平台性以及众多Java特征,所以理解Java虚拟机对于理解Java编程具有较多的实际意义。一方面理解Java虚拟机能够提升代码编写的执行效率,另一方面也会充分发挥Java虚拟机赋予Java语言的各种能力,好的Java程序员一定对于Java的开发边界有清晰的把握。

第三:对于Java扩展性的理解。Java最重要的优点就包括Java语言稳定的性能表现和较强的扩展性,对于Java扩展性的理解就涉及到Java的模块化开发。模块化开发一直是Java的重点内容,早期不少Java程序员会借助OSGI来完成模块的动态扩展,现在Java自身增加了模块化支持之后,能够充分理解并运用Java的模块化对于程序员来说还是比较重要的,尤其是研发级程序员。

我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。

如果有互联网、大数据、人工智能等方面的问题,或者是考研方面的问题,都可以在评论区留言!

版权说明:
本网站凡注明“广州京杭 原创”的皆为本站原创文章,如需转载请注明出处!
本网转载皆注明出处,遵循行业规范,如发现作品内容版权或其它问题的,请与我们联系处理!
欢迎扫描右侧微信二维码与我们联系。
·上一条:kitsunebi如何导入规则集_java | ·下一条:使用java如何打造分布式框架或系统_java

Copyright © 广州京杭网络科技有限公司 2005-2025 版权所有    粤ICP备16019765号 

广州京杭网络科技有限公司 版权所有